Design and describe your business processesUsing our process modeler you can design, describe and configure your business processes. Each process-step can be linked to reference models such as CMMI, ISO, SOX, COBIT or project management frameworks such as Prince2, PMBOK or DSDM Atern. Defined processes can be published to a process portal and process documents can be generated. | |

Run agile projectsUse Crocus to manage your agile or SCRUM projects. Plan work using userstories, storypoints, sprints/timeboxes or iterations and track the productivity of the team and progress of the project through the velocity and burndown charts. | |
Portfolio ManagementA portfolio or project-group is a group of projects and process-instances belonging together. You can group projects together that belong to a specific customer, customer group, division or any other way you want to group them. Create portfolio status report and get total group statistics. | |
